Rainbows
Description | The Rainbows programme supports children and young people affected by loss due to bereavement, separation or divorce. The service is available in local communities throughout Ireland. The Rainbow service is free of charge and is partly funded by Tusla and the Child and Family Agency. Rainbows is available in schools family resource centres and parish centres. It is not therapy, professional counselling or clinical professional support, we are a listening service for children and young people struggling to come to terms with significant loss and change in their lives. |

CAMHS (Child and Adolescent Mental Health Service) South Meath
Description | The HSE Child and Adolescent Mental Health Services (CAMHS) is a specialist service for people under the age of 18 with mental health difficulties. These are difficulties that affect your thoughts, feelings and behaviours every day. Some conditions treated in CAMHS include: - moderate to severe depression - anxiety - eating disorders - self-harm |
